About Quarter Life Crisis (2026) — A Journey of Self-Discovery Amidst Quarter Life Chaos

Get ready to embark on a thrilling journey of self-discovery with Quarter Life Crisis (2026), a thought-provoking documentary that delves into the chaos of growing up amidst impossible expectations. Director Cade Huseby takes us on a 25-day countdown to his 25th birthday, consulting a colorful cast of experts along the way. From the pressures of adulthood to the quest for identity, this film is a wild ride that will leave you questioning the very fabric of quarter life crisis.

As Cade navigates the ups and downs of young adulthood, we're introduced to a cast of characters that will make you laugh, cry, and reflect on your own life choices.
